Prepping your skin using a face and/or body scrub before beginning your tanning process not only removes a build-up of dead skin but will result in a smooth base for your fake tan so be sure to start 24 hours before you plan to tan. Next step, moisturising. Formulas in fake tan tend to cling to dry skin so applying a rich moisturising lotion to your skin beforehand will keep your self-tan from looking patchy whilst keeping your skin soft and hydrated. If you're torn between tanning drops and bronzing drops, let us break down the difference. Self-tanning drops impart a lasting radiance to the skin, courtesy of DHA; think self-tanner specifically made for your face. If you’re looking for a short-term solution to your fading summer colour, we’d opt for bronzing drops. How do you apply self-tan drops?To build a gradual tan, start with just a few drops to achieve a subtle hint of color and assess it 24 hours after your application. Then, increase the number of drops gradually. “In subsequent applications, you can add an additional one to two extra drops to your mixture,” says Claghorn. “Keep an eye on how your skin responds to each application and adjust the number of drops accordingly — this approach allows you to achieve a natural-looking, gradual tan without any sudden or dramatic changes.” To spice up a matte foundation, mix it with a dot of this liquid highlighter to transform the formula into one that is luminous and hydrating. We asked Michaella Bolder, St. Tropez tanning and skincare expert, for her tips on how to make your tan last for longer. “ Exfoliation is an essential first step — exfoliate at least a few hours before you apply a new layer of self-tan,” she advises. “It's also important to avoid using any oil-based shower gels or moisturisers ahead of tanning, as the oil will act as a barrier to the tan and prevent it from developing.

Hart adds that “building your tan gradually will ensure you don’t end up feeling too dark or with an uneven base.” D-Bronzi from Drunk Elephant is perhaps the most well-known bronzer on this list.
